WORCESTER – Morton “Morty” Sreiberg, age 98, died unexpectedly on Thursday, January 1, 2026, at St. Vincent Hospital in Worcester. Morty was born in Pandėlys, Lithuania, the son of Michel and Eva (Zelovitsky) Sreiberg.
At the age of 11 Morty moved to Worcester where his family settled on the east side. After graduating from Commerce High School, he enlisted in the U.S. Navy, proudly serving his country during World War II. Morty married the love of his life, Isabell “Issy” (Shnider) and they raised their family in Worcester. They purchased their home on Greybert Lane in 1961 where they remained for 64 blessed years.
In 1953 Morty opened M and I Cleaners, which he operated for over 36 years. Together they raised their children as active members of Congregation Beth Israel where Morty served on many committees and was appointed as a Life Member of the Beth Israel Board in recognition of his constant dedication. He was also a member of the Col. Irving Yarock Jewish War Veterans Post #32.
Morty will be lovingly missed and remembered by his devoted children, Jeffrey Sreiberg and his wife, Debbie , and grandson David, of New Market, Ontario, Canada, and Cheryl Vati Sreiberg and her partner John Dearie of Worthington, MA, and step-granddaughter Brynne Dearie of Costa Rica; and many beloved nieces, nephews and cousins. He was predeceased by his cherished wife of 76 years, Isabell “Issy” (Shnider) Sreiberg just seven months ago, his brother, Ben Sreiberg, and his sister, Sarah Entin.
